This three-volume set, LNCS 15788-15790, constitutes the refereed proceedings of the 17th International Conference on Virtual, Augmented and Mixed Reality, VAMR 2025, held as part of the 27th International Conference on Human-Computer Interaction, HCII 2025, in Gothenburg, Sweden, during June 22–27, 2025.
The total of 1430 papers and 355 posters included in the HCII 2025 proceedings were carefully reviewed and selected from 7972 submissions.
The papers presented in these three volumes are organized in the following topical sections::
Part I: Designing and Developing Virtual Environments; UX in Virtual Environments
Part II: VR, Culture, Art and Entertainment; Social Interaction and Wellbeing in Virtual Environments
Part III: VR Games; Virtual Environments for Learning, Training and Professional Development; Multimodal Interaction in Virtual Environments
